Can't Smeg, Won't Smeg is a one-off episode of Can't Cook, Won't Cook guest starring the cast of Red Dwarf.

Overview[]

Television chef Ainsley Harriott beams himself aboard the space vessel Starbug to test the crew's culinary skills. The programme therefore has a unique 'half-and-half' status with regard to being in or out of the Red Dwarf universe.

Summary[]

One special episode aired under the name "Can't Smeg, Won't Smeg" as part of the 10th anniversary of the Red Dwarf series; this appears on the Series IV DVD. The Red Dwarf cast participated in the show entirely in character. Ainsley Harriott, the host chef for the episode, had previously performed a small role in the Red Dwarf episode "Emohawk: Polymorph II". Dave Lister and Kryten face off against Arnold Rimmer and Duane Dibbley, as Cat did not want to be on the same team as Rimmer.

The host of Can't Cook, Won't Cook teaches the teams how to cook a curry with Kristine Kochanski as taste test judge. The show was won by Rimmer and Duane, not surprising considering they stole Ainsley's rice and cucumber yoghurt.

Key Moments[]

  • Lister eats half a jar of curry paste and drinks from the can of coconut milk before pouring the rest into the curry.
  • Rimmer keeps Ainsley occupied while Danny/Duane swaps their rice with Ainsley's.
  • Ainsley realises whilst dishing up that Chris and Danny have also nicked his cucumber and tomato yoghurt.
  • Kryten clears the workstation with his Groinal Attachment.
  • After Lister stares at Kochanski's butt, he asks why girls always hit people when they can't think of a witty retort. Kochanski responds by hitting him in the face with a pan.
  • Ainsley saws off Robert's groinal attachment with an electric carver.
  • Duane enters through the waste disposal.
  • Ainsley reacts when they show him the ingredients they've brought along in a section of the show mimicking another cooking program, Ready, Steady, Cook: a dead Space Weevil, a pot noodle, two bottles of Urine Recyc Wine, an innersole, a Mimian bladder fish, rice pudding made in the bowl Duane uses to get his hair cut, and Caroline Carmen's ear.
  • Duane's surprising knife skills.
  • Lister asking if it's all right to bleed on the food.
  • Kochanski makes faces throughout the whole thing; she is ultimately the taste-tester.
  • Ainsley nearly burns his rice. Lister says, "Well that's not very professional is it?"
  • As the credits roll, everyone discovers how horrible Lister and Kryten's curry is.
